No problem. Since the start of the current decade:
1. Georgia - 42-2 (.955)
2. Alabama - 36-6 (.857)
3. Ole Miss - 29-10 (.725)
4. Tennessee - 27-12 (.692)
5. LSU - 26-14 (.650)
6. Kentucky - 24-15 (.615)
7. Missouri - 23-16 (.590)
8. Mississippi State - 21-17 (.568)
9. Texas A&M - 20-17 (.541)
10. Arkansas - 20-18 (.526)
10. South Carolina - 20-18 (.526)
12. Florida 17-21 (.447)
12. Auburn 17-21 (.447)
14. Vanderbilt 9-27 (.250)

Please elaborate
Auburn's downward trend started with Malzahn.
It began when substitution rules were changed and his no huddle lost its advantage.
It escalated as our defense turned into swiss cheese and outscoring opponents wasn't so easy. (see above)
It mediated a bit when Malzahn was forced to hire Muschamp and we rebuilt the defensive roster. For several years, Kevin Steele's defense saved Gus' job.
Soon stacking the line became an easy defense because Malzahn didn't feel the need to recruit offensive linemen and said as much. His offense, save for a blip with Jared Stidham and Bo Nix running for his life was completely ineffective. The very few of his players that went to the NFL were unprepared and had to practically relearn the game.
Our roster was a disaster when Harsin came to town. Harsin didn't feel the need to recruit, so it got worse. The only reason Hugh Freeze was hired was his ability to recruit and that hole was dug entirely by Gus Malzahn.
So, there ya go.
